Bottas to Ferrari? Silly Season off to an early start
Reports in Italy suggest Valtteri Bottas's Formula 1 future may well be coloured in red. Former double world champion Mika Hakkinen, now involved in the management of the Williams driver's career, said this week that if he was the decision-maker at Ferrari, he is not sure he would retain Kimi Raikkonen. On the other hand, 'Valtteri showed how well he can handle the pressure' as he raced Sebastian Vettel in Bahrain, Hakkinen told his sponsor Hermes in an interview. 'It was exactly the sort of strong nerves that drivers need in the fight for world championships,' he insisted. Media sources now suggest that Bottas may have already penned a preliminary contract with Maranello based Ferrari....
